The Effect of Long-term EU Budget 2021-2027 and Recovery Package on Croatia's Post PandemicEconomic Recovery

In ten years time Croatia will undoubtedly become a richer country in absolute terms. However, the real question remains whether Croatia will succeed in narrowing its development gap with the rest of the EU, in order to stem the emigration of its brightest citizens and to attract new talents from abroad. This can be averted by smarter and more efficient use of EU funds, as described above. Furthermore, EU funds are not a panacea and they can only work their true magic if complemented by an ambitious set of economic and political reforms. Unless current and future Croatian Governements do not commit to pro-market reforms and the burgeoning public sector remains at the core of state-led growth model, the historical opportunity to catch-up more developed EU peers will be irreparaby lost. Therefore, the current Croatian Government should institute far more ambitious reforms than those outlined in the NRRP. EC will definitely track Croatia’s progress within the European Semester and institute potential sanctions if cases of egregious misuse of EU funds occur or no reforms at all are implemented. However, it is not reasonable to expect that the EC shall use its power to press any Croatian Government to focus on high-hanging fruits, or reforms that contain the biggest potential to significantly lift Croatia’s potential growth rate. This is only and alone up to a reform-minded Croatian Government that knows how to compensate opponents of those reforms by major financial shot in the arm from the long-term EU budget and RRF. Over next three years there are no elections in sight. This is the right opportunity and timing to embark on this reform agenda for the sake of all Croatians and their European peers.
